For example, take a look on the output of this connection with the -v switch (key signatures, domain and IP ... WebThe sshd_config is the ssh daemon (or ssh server process) configuration file. As you've already stated, this is the file you'll need to modify to change the server port. Whereas, the ssh_config file is the ssh client configuration file. The client configuration file only has bearing on when you use the ssh command to connect to another ssh host. I already tried ssh -F /path/to/configfile, ... WebMar 21, 2024 · To change a parameter in the sshd_config file, uncomment the line that contains the parameter. To do this, remove the number-sign character (#) and change the value for the line. Important: If you change the default SSH port, you must update your server’s firewall configuration to allow traffic to the new port.

WebEditing config files on Windows and transfering them back to Linux is dangerous because Windows uses different line breaks than Linux. You should rather edit the file directly on the remote machine by typing sudo nano /etc/ssh/sshd_config make your changes and press CTRL+O to save and CTRL+X to exit.
